This operation has been performed at Åsgard since 2003.The Modular Downhole Tractor (MDT) The modular downhole tractor is a wireline deployed system use to convey wireline tool, sumassembly or perforating gun into difficult-to-access areas. There are 3 main equipments of MDT that are wireline tractor, wireline stroker, and wireline key.Wireline Tractor Wireline trator services were commercially introduced in 1996, aiming to provide a highly cost-effective alternative to coil tubing and snubbing interventions in horizontal and high-angle wells. This technology was primary used for conveyance of diagnotis logging tools and traditional operation such as perforation and plug setting. Because it achieved a reliable track record, wireline tractor was applied with other technologies for do a specific job in, especially, horizontal and high-deviated well.

As shown in figure 1, wireline tractor is modular enabling a number of sections, which are electronics section connect with actuator and drive arm/wheels below. In order to provide the maximum force to drive the passenger tool combination along the well, wireline tractor use DC powerd in control panals and communications section while the remaning parts and functions are hydraulic. So it can drive both up and downhole. When actived, the wheels are hydraulically deployed out of the body and start to rotate automatically. Each wheel rotates by its own independent hydralic motor. The tool centralized it self once the wheels contact casing.

The cummative traction force deploys the passenger tools into the wellbore. When it reachs the target, the tool is powered down.Wireline Stroker Conventional wireline jars are usually used in vertical and slightly deviated wells during retrieval of plug or activated some downhole assembly. In case of high angle and horizontal well, a special tractor jar, which is call wireline stroker, has been designed.

It connects below wireline tractor. As shown in figure 2, wireline stroker is devided into electronic section and hydraulic section. The upper section is used as command reciever while the lower section allows mechanical operation to be carried out. When combined with a wireline shifting tool, the wireline stroker applied the required force to shift downhole valves or SSDs.

The maximum axial force is upto 33,000 lbs bi-direction. Additionally, the force provided can be replace the use of explosives in packer setting application, which increase operational safety, provide environmental benefit and easier logistic.Wireline Intelligence Shifting Tool Wireline key is used as special shifting tool, it connect below wireline stroker. As shown in figure 3, the wireline key contains a pair of keypads arranged at 180-degree angle. The tool is activated by axial force generated from wireline stroker, which is controlled from surface. When activated, a hydraulic pump extends the keypad with a specific profile out of the tool body, which allows them to latch onto a matching shifting profile.

For example latch on SSD key profile, the sliding sleeves are pushed or pulled until it closed or opened completely. If it deactivated the keypads are retracted into the tool body. Wireline key enable access through minimum restrictions because it can shift selectively. So the operator can do multiple jobs in the single run if it uses the same key profile. It provides operational time saving and allows flexibility for completion engineer to design wells with lots of downhole hardware without shifting mechanial restriction.

Use of Wireline Tractor on Logging Program Wireline tractor technology is now a conveyance method for Production logging tool (PLT) in horizontal wells. The logging jobs were completed safely and successfully at flowing and shut-in conditions. Usage of DC motor in tractor technology allows logging tool to operate at different speeds due to surface controller. Normally, most of the horizontal wells are drilled and logged using logging while drilling (LWD) technology, which have some limitation.

Once PLT with wireline tractor runs, the wellbore profile is clearly understood. The wireline tractor is a good deployment solution and alternative for horizontal logging application. It has proved its flexibility and reliability to overcome the severe well trajectory and different sizes of washout in openhole applicationSucessful Case Historywith Wireline Tractor Technology Case I, in late 2006 at Norway, a lowest SSD located at the depth of 4,334-m MD with an angle exceed 70°. It was programmed to close by wireline tractor, wireline stroker, and intelligent wireline shifting tool. Two upward strokes were performed during the operation in single, the first upstroke is to close the sleeve and the second upstroke is to verify that the sleeve is completely closed.

The actual time taken to close SSD was just 15 minutes. The benefit of this operation is time saving. Case II, a newly drilled horizontal well has 91.7° maximum deviation with total depth of 6272-m. This well was program to set plug and shifting SSD followed by retriving the plug.

The first run is to set plug at depth 4061-m MD by wireline trator as a conveyance. The plug was set with explosive setting tool. Total time in well was about 15 hour. The next run was combination of wireline tractor and wireline stroker for closing SSD. Total time in well was 13 hours.

The final run was made to pull the plug after testing anullus pressure.The entire operation was completed successfully with zero personal injury and zero hour lost time. Case III, an internal leakage in tubing was found in a 4979-m MD deviated well in the North Sea. Production rate from this well was about 100 sm3/day with 80% water cut and gas-to-oil ratio was 2,100.

In order to serve this problem, the straddle packer was used to isolate the leakage zone. The biggest challenge was too long leakage zone required too long straddle packer.Conventional rig counld not be used due to accommodate restriction. So it was decided to use 8-m single straddle packer to isolate SSD and installed 22-m multi-section straddle packer to isolate leakage zone as shown in figure 4. There are 5 runs of wireline tractor/stroker combination required. First, lower the straddle packer.

Wireline stroker activated the element of straddle packer in run 2 and 3. Two strokes per element were performed to ensure physical matching and proper sealing.The typical stroke time is 25 seconds. In run 4, the top packer was anchored and the final run was to install the top packer. The entire operation took a total of 32.5 hours.

The successful operation causes water cut reducing to less than 5%. Gas-to-oil ratio decreases from 2,000 to 200. Oil rate increases from 100 sm3/day to 900 sm3/day. The combination of wireline tractor/stroker was proved in repairing a well completion with reliable of considerable saving in personal, logistic and overall planning.Applying of Wireline Tractor Scale Milling Technology with RLWI Wireline tractor had been applied with scale milling tool in Smørbukk field of MidNorway in 2008 for the first time.

The newly technology came to replace the traditionally scale milling operation performed with semi-submersible rigs and coil tubing. The concept of Riserless Ligh Well Intervention (RLWI) is base on use of subsea invention well control package including a lubricator with no high-pressure riser tied back to the vessel. There are 4 main equipments of subsea lubricator system as shown in figure 5.The First is the lower intervention package (LIP), it has two barrier valves and a shear seal ram.

The second is the lower lubricator package (LLP); it has subsea grease system and workover mudule system. The third is the upper lubricator package (ULP); it has cutting ballvalve combine with lubricator tubular. The fourth is the pressure control head (PCH); it consists of wireline flow tubes and emergency packing elements. The lubricator allows deployment of tool strings up to 22-m.

The Milling Bottom Hole Assembly The bottomhole assembly consisted of a wireline tractor, rotation adapter, gearbox, shock absorber and the milling assembly. The total length of BHA was 11.3-m. The rotation adapter was connected between wireline tractor and the gearbox.

It is a hydraulic moter module recieves power from wireline tractor for providing torque and rotation to the gearbox beltrow. The wireline tractor milling concept is base on low torque and high RPM. The gearbox deliver a maximum of 90 revolutions per minutes (rpm) and maximum torque output of 160-Nm while shock absorber, under the gearbox, provide sustainable weight on bit and allow axial travel.The milling assembly consists of costomized bit and specially designed reamer for associated with wireline tractor.

As shown in figure 6, milling bit has four separate freely rotating cutting cone. It optimize for cutting grinding scale into fine particles. The reamer is placed over the bit and acts as a stabilizer for milling assembly. A rotation counter incorperated in rotational adapter is one of the most recent functionalities introduced for wireline tractor milling survice. This feature facilitates real time feedback of actual bit rotational at hold up depth.

This help operator to optimize weight on bit and RPM by adjust wireline cable tension for increaing milling efficiency.Case History The operation described in this topic was performed at Smørbukk. It is a high temperature gas condensate subsea field and produced mainly by depletion with some pressure support from gas injection. Scale plugging in linver around perforation zone had been found in 2003. It was first removed by coil tubing invention however; scale bridge hadn’t been removed completely. Until 2008, it was decided to plug off a gas break-though from the lowest reservoir zone so scale milling required again.

Wireline tractor milling in a high temperature combined to Riserless Light Well Intervention (RLWI) equipment was first performed here in order to complete this operation. Scale was tagged at 4,044-m MD and 11-m of scale was milled in the first run with in 22 hours. On the second run, 7-m of scale was milled in 15 hours. The final run 5-m of scale was milled in 10 hours.

4The wireline tractor was in good condition when it was checked on deck. A PLT was run after scale milling process in order to evaluate the contribution. X-Y caliper in the string showed no scale left in plug setting area. So the bridge plug was installed completely A major benefit during milling operation was rotation counter that mounted on wireline tractor although RLWI was time consuming operation compare to traditional surface wireline operation.
